Understanding the Multiplier and Risk Management

The core mechanic of the game revolves around the multiplier, which begins at 1x and relentlessly increases as the ‘airplane’ ascends. This represents the potential return on your initial bet. A multiplier of 2x means a doubling of your stake, 3x triples it, and so on. The crucial element is recognizing that this multiplier isn’t guaranteed to continue rising indefinitely. The game operates on a random number generator (RNG), meaning the point at which the plane flies away is unpredictable. Therefore, risk management is paramount. Players must decide on a target multiplier – a point at which they are comfortable securing a profit – and cash out their bet before the plane takes off. Waiting for the highest possible multiplier can be tempting, but it significantly increases the risk of losing everything. Many players start with small bets to get a feel for the game and gradually increase their wagers as they refine their strategy.

Analyzing Historical Data and Patterns

While the game is ultimately based on chance, some players attempt to identify patterns in the results by analyzing historical data. Many platforms provide statistics on past rounds, including the multipliers reached and the average time it takes for the plane to "fly away." This data can be used to identify potential trends, such as periods of increased volatility or higher average multipliers. However, it's crucial to remember that past performance is not indicative of future results. The RNG ensures that each round is independent of the previous ones. Nonetheless, for some players, analyzing the data adds an extra layer of engagement and a sense of control. They might look for instances where the multiplier consistently reaches a certain level before crashing, or identify periods where the plane tends to fly away early.

The Limitations of Pattern Recognition

It’s important to approach pattern recognition with a degree of skepticism. The RNG is designed to produce truly random outcomes, making it extremely difficult to predict future results with any degree of accuracy. What might appear to be a pattern could simply be a random occurrence. Furthermore, game providers often update their RNG algorithms to ensure fairness and prevent exploitation. Therefore, relying solely on historical data is not a reliable strategy for winning. It can, however, be a useful tool for understanding the game’s overall behavior and adjusting your strategy accordingly. The key is to use it as one piece of the puzzle, rather than the sole basis for your decisions.
